JKS NORGE AS is registered as a limited company in Oslo, Oslo with organisation number 991922245. The business is classified under temporary employment agency activities and other human resource provisions (NACE 78.200). The company was incorporated in 2007 and has 263 registered employees. Registered share capital is NOK 1.2m, divided into 1000 shares. The company's stated purpose is: “Utleie og formidling av arbeidskraft, konsulentbistand, samt alt hva hermed står i forbindelse.”. The most recent filed accounts, for the 2024 financial year, show NOK 54.2m in revenue and NOK −952,000 in operating profit.
